Note that this document has beta status and refers to a version of
PSTricks that is still in beta. The transparency features require
version 1.16b of PSTricks, while the current version on CTAN is 1.15. I
believe Herbert has said he expects to officially release version 1.16
by the end of the year.
In the meantime, you have two options. One is to install the beta
version, which you can do using the pstricks.tex and pstricks.pro files
from the same directory where you found pst-news2007.pdf. The other
option is to use the transparency features in the pstricks-add package.
I have done the latter with great success.
